Owning a property built around 175o offers a combination of cultural prestige, architectural durability, and unique financial opportunities that modern homes cannot replicate.

1. Cultural and Historical Stewardship

a) Unique History: You become a steward of a tangible piece of history that has survived multiple eras and historical events.

b) Community Identity: Historic homes often serve as pillars of their local community, anchoring the neighbourhood’s character and heritage.

c) Irreplaceable Aesthetic: These homes feature hand-crafted architectural details that are no longer standard, such as exposed wooden beams, hand-carved woodwork, stone fireplaces, and thick lath-and-plaster walls that provide excellent sound insulation.

2. Financial and Tax Advantages

a) Tax Exemptions: Some buildings of ”outstanding interest” can be exempt from Inheritance Tax and Capital Gains Tax when passed to a new owner as a gift or upon death, provided they meet specific heritage criteria.

b) Renovation Grants: Organisations in Slovenia frequently offer financial assistance or grants for essential repairs to maintain historical integrity.

c) Resale Premium: Well-maintained historic properties often command a premium of 9% to 23% over comparable modern properties in the same area.

d) Potential for Income: Historical estates can generate revenue through cultural tours, filming locations, or as high-end vacation rentals (e.g., Airbnb).

3. Superior Physical Attributes

a) Construction Quality: Older homes were typically built with durable, high-quality materials like solid stone, brick, and old-growth hardwood that often outlast modern mass-produced materials.

b) Larger Plots: 400-year-old properties are often situated on larger plots of land with established gardens and mature trees, which are rarely found in modern developments.

c) Prime Location: Most such properties are centrally located in historic town cores or established rural areas with better access to local amenities.

4. Environmental Sustainability

a) Lower Carbon Footprint: Refurbishing a 400-year-old structure is often more environmentally friendly than new construction due to the ”embodied carbon” already present in the existing materials.

b) Natural Insulation: Thicker stone or brick walls can offer natural thermal mass, which helps regulate temperatures more effectively than some mid-century builds.

Why Slovenia?

In 2026, Slovenia continues to be recognised as a leading European destination for its high quality of life, environmental sustainability, and geostrategy.

1. Quality of Life and Safety

a) Top-Tier Safety: Slovenia is consistently ranked among the top 10 safest countries globally, currently holding the 9th spot for safety.

b) Happiness and Wellbeing: In 2025, Slovenia reached its highest ever ranking in the World Happiness Report at 19th place.

c) Work-Life Balance: The culture strongly prioritizes personal time, with a standard 8-hour workday and an emphasis on outdoor recreation over long working hours.

2. Environmental Leadership

a) Pristine Nature: Over 60% of the territory is covered by forest, making it the third most forested country in Europe.

b) Sustainable Tourism: Slovenia is a global leader in ”green” travel. In 2026, Condé Nast Traveler named the Upper Carniola (Gorenjska) region one of the best places to visit in Europe due to its sustainable developments.

c) Clean Resources: High-quality potable water is available directly from the tap nationwide.

3. Economic and Business Advantages

a) Strategic Location: Located at the heart of Europe, Slovenia serves as a geostatregic bridge between Western Europe and the Balkans, providing easy access to over 700 million customers within the EU market.

b) Innovation Hub: The country ranks 9th globally in high-tech exports and is a pioneer in technologies like blockchain and artificial intelligence.

c) Digital Nomad Friendly: Slovenia has introduced a digital nomad visa, making it highly attractive for remote workers seeking a European base with modern infrastructure and reliable public services.

4. Cultural and Educational Benefits

a) Multilingualism: Proficiency in foreign languages is among the highest in Europe; most citizens under 30 speak English fluently, and many are trilingual (often including German or Italian).

b) Affordable Education: Higher education is often free or low-cost for EU residents, with prestigious institutions like the University of Ljubljana ranking in the top 3% of universities worldwide.

c) 2026 Cultural Milestones: Ptuj has been named ”Europe’s Best Cultural Heritage Town 2026”.
The UNESCO-listed Škofja Loka Passion Play will be performed in Spring 2026, an event that occurs only once every six years.

5. Cost of Living

a) While housing in the capital (Ljubljana) can be expensive, the overall cost of living remains significantly lower than in Western European nations like France, Italy, or Austria.

b) Healthcare: Legal residents have access to a universal, high-quality healthcare system funded through state taxes.
